Output 23abbd5288f86f3144c18d2431d395c9a74f67c2eaa1b21892df0b8ed176a137:0

value
46220289
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0000278bdb2e078abddcce378906a4b2a0adf416 OP_EQUALVERIFY OP_CHECKSIG
address
LKDxSwqfdf3arLFYSk9NLNMSSxkpALHZaW
transaction
23abbd5288f86f3144c18d2431d395c9a74f67c2eaa1b21892df0b8ed176a137
spent
true